Output ad8658c49b221c33d3291dab901a866860b250108546b7c51fb9ad1dc17b73e7:53

value
2045921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190f11edec68e335b3b9386b2eb92a52cff47158 OP_EQUAL
address
33yWsRYertzeXbBihVPKeT6Zsv9YPwE1YR
transaction
ad8658c49b221c33d3291dab901a866860b250108546b7c51fb9ad1dc17b73e7
confirmations
203593
spent
true